What Is a Rock and Roll Kitchen Concept

A rock and roll kitchen refers to a restaurant concept that integrates music heritage, rock memorabilia, and celebrity chef branding into its dining model. These venues often combine themed décor, live or curated music programming, and menu items tied to cultural icons. The model targets customers seeking experiential dining where food, music, and nostalgia intersect. Forbes reports that experiential dining concepts have grown as a segment within the broader restaurant industry, with themed venues attracting both tourists and local repeat visitors.

Rock and roll kitchen brands often rely on licensing deals, trademarked menu names, and exclusive merchandise to create additional revenue streams beyond core food sales. The kitchen operations in these venues typically emphasize open-fire cooking, visible preparation areas, and high-energy service models aligned with the rock aesthetic. According to industry analyses, such concepts can command higher average checks when the brand resonates with a defined audience. The model has expanded beyond standalone restaurants into hotel dining, event spaces, and touring pop-up formats.

Major restaurant groups and celebrity chef platforms have launched or invested in rock and roll kitchen branded concepts in recent years. Companies linked to rock culture have used private equity, venture capital, and brand licensing to scale these formats. SEC filings and public disclosures show that restaurant-focused funds have allocated capital to concepts with strong thematic IP, including music-related dining brands. The funding environment for themed restaurant concepts remains tied to consumer spending trends and brand durability.

Valuations for rock and roll kitchen style concepts often depend on location density, brand recognition, and the strength of associated intellectual property. Some ventures have pursued franchise-style expansion while others remain company-owned flagship operations. Industry data indicates that concepts with clear differentiation, such as music-driven themes, can achieve higher unit economics in high-traffic urban markets. Investors track same-store sales growth and brand extension potential when evaluating these concepts for further capital deployment.

Operational and Financial Metrics

Operational performance for rock and roll kitchen venues is typically measured through average transaction value, table turnover, and merchandise attach rates. Themed restaurants often report higher per-visit spend when the experience includes exclusive menu items, limited-edition merch, and music-related events. Revenue diversification across food, beverage, retail, and event hosting helps stabilize cash flow compared with standard dining formats.

Financial reporting for publicly traded restaurant operators shows that concepts with strong cultural themes can sustain premium pricing if execution matches brand expectations. Labor costs, supply chain management for themed menu items, and maintenance of proprietary equipment are key cost drivers. Companies with rock and roll kitchen concepts often disclose segment-level performance in annual reports, highlighting revenue from branded merchandise and licensing alongside core restaurant sales.
